How they compare
Viet Nam currently reports 5.32 against 5.04 in Zimbabwe, a difference of 0.28.
That makes Viet Nam's figure about 1.1 times Zimbabwe's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Viet Nam ahead.
Viet Nam ranks 97th and Zimbabwe ranks 100th of 144 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Viet Nam averaged higher in 4 and Zimbabwe in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Viet Nam | Zimbabwe |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 1.31 | 1.27 | 0.045 | Viet Nam |
| 1970s | 1.36 | 1.37 | 0.01 | Zimbabwe |
| 1980s | 1.42 | 1.96 | 0.53 | Zimbabwe |
| 1990s | 3.23 | 2.51 | 0.715 | Viet Nam |
| 2000s | 4.74 | 3.42 | 1.32 | Viet Nam |
| 2010s | 5.32 | 5.04 | 0.28 | Viet Nam |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
